>Recap: Acquisition Q&A Session with Lition CEO Richard Lohwasser from October 28th

Lition and Tomochain made headlines on October 28th with the announcement that TomoChain had acquired the enterprise blockchain unit of Lition. You can read the full acquisition announcement here.
Lition Founder and CEO Richard Lohwasser stopped by the Lition Telegram after the announcement for an impromptu Q&A session.
Introduction

Richard Lohwasser (RL): Dear community members, I see there are many questions about the recent announcement. I will join a video AMA this Friday together with TomoChain’s CEO, Long Vuong, to address the main questions that came up. What I can tell you already now is that the new entity will be a lot more powerful than the old one.

>Q: Will you be leaving Lition?
RL: I won’t. The Blockchain is still the core of the energy business (all the trades run on it), and I will also remain active in the new Blockchain infrastructure company.

>Q: Why an Acquisition?
RL: More on this on the AMA, but we realized that a new, merged company is a lot more powerful than a sole Lition alone. We needed a partner beyond a partnership.
Lition has a European Sidechain solution — but no mainnet*, no international footprint, and by far not the resource of a TomoChain. But these resources are needed if you want to play in the major league.
That’s exactly what we want to do. and need to, if we really want to make a difference. And that’s what we will do now.
